其他分享
首页 > 其他分享> > “烫烫烫”和“屯屯屯”

“烫烫烫”和“屯屯屯”

作者:互联网

在VC++编译器中,未初始化的数组会自动填充0xcc。如,运行如下的代码:

 

 

运行结果:

 

 

原因:把0xcc当作中文进行输出,两个0xcc组成一个中文字符,也就是“烫”

 

而在堆上分配的内存,系统会自动填充0xcd,转换为中文就是“屯”

 

 

运行结果:

 

标签:屯屯,中文,填充,烫烫,编译器,自动,0xcc,运行
来源: https://www.cnblogs.com/jisuanjizhishizatan/p/15153714.html